'A Novato woman won't be charged with a crime after her husband's body was found underneath a barbecue pit she built in their yard, her attorney said Tuesday.

The body of Dale Smith, 74, was found Feb. 23 buried at least 4 feet beneath the patio of the home he shared with his wife, Evelyn Smith, 55, investigators said.

Neighbors had not seen Dale Smith since at least September 2010. It was around that time that his wife and two laborers put in a brick barbecue pit in the backyard of the home on Rebecca Way, neighbors said.'
